Recipe
The Hedgehog Cheese Ball is a delightful and whimsical appetizer that combines creamy cheese with crunchy almonds to create a visually stunning centerpiece for any gathering. This recipe transforms a classic cheese ball into an adorable hedgehog shape, perfect for impressing guests at parties or adding a touch of fun to a casual snack spread.
With its blend of cream cheese, sharp cheddar, and nutty almonds, this appetizer offers a perfect balance of flavors and textures. The dried cranberries and peppercorns used for the facial features add a touch of sweetness and spice, making this hedgehog not only cute but also delicious.
- 16 oz cream cheese, softened
- 2 cups sharp cheddar cheese, shredded
- 2 cups sliced almonds
- 2 dried cranberries
- 2 black peppercorns
- Crackers or sliced baguette for serving
In a large bowl, mix the softened cream cheese and shredded cheddar cheese until well combined. Shape the mixture into an oval or egg shape to form the hedgehog’s body. Carefully insert the sliced almonds all over the surface, pointing outward to create the appearance of spines. Use dried cranberries for the eyes and black peppercorns for the nose.
Refrigerate the cheese ball for at least an hour before serving to allow it to firm up. For best results, remove the cheese ball from the refrigerator about 15 minutes before serving to allow it to soften slightly, making it easier to spread.
If preparing this dish in advance, you can make the cheese mixture and shape it ahead of time, but wait to add the almond “spines” until just before serving to ensure they maintain their crispness. Serve with an assortment of crackers or sliced baguette for a complete and charming appetizer experience.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I Use Different Types of Cheese for the Hedgehog Cheese Ball?
Absolutely! You can experiment with various cheese combinations to create unique flavor profiles. Try mixing sharp cheddar with creamy goat cheese, or blend Swiss with smoky Gouda. Don’t be afraid to get creative with your cheese choices!
How Long Can I Store the Hedgehog Cheese Ball in the Refrigerator?
Like the enduring tale of the tortoise, your cheese ball can last. You can store it in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. For optimal freshness, keep it tightly wrapped. Don’t forget refrigerator tips: avoid strong odors nearby.
Are There Any Nut-Free Alternatives for the Almond “Spines”?
You’ve got options for nut-free “spines”! Try sunflower seeds or pumpkin seeds for a similar crunch. Pretzel sticks can work too, giving a unique texture. For a cheesy twist, you can even use broken cheese crisps as spines.
Can I Freeze the Hedgehog Cheese Ball for Later Use?
While you might worry about texture changes, you can freeze the cheese ball. Just don’t add the “spines” before freezing. Wrap it tightly in plastic and foil. Thaw in the fridge overnight for best results when you’re ready to serve.
